Transaction c3c3437ecc74ecc979e2235d0e3a1dfa5e6fa205a47eccfcad52a75b2aa6ad62
1 Input
1 Outputs
- c3c3437ecc74ecc979e2235d0e3a1dfa5e6fa205a47eccfcad52a75b2aa6ad62:0
value 8009028
address 1KuDkNdrUB9bpdAEwccpsvYAo8DrWkJWPU